Last month at the 2025 Outsider Art Fair I gave some kids a disposable camera and asked them to take photos of their favorite artworks.
Shout out to these kids for liking great art and their parents for taking them to the greatest art fair around. Thanks for giving me permission to share these photos!

Shout out to Gayle Uyagaqi Kabloona, a multi-media artist and advocate for Intuit causes, including setting the record straight when it comes to the thousands of years of Inuit’s treking the Baffin Island in Canada — as well as Kabloona herself who has hiked from Qikiqtarjuaq to Pangnirtung (which spans 1500 kilometers) with others several times!

MIKE COMBS is a self-taught artist from Austin, Texas who for the past decade has been creating “Creeps” on up cycled husk corn crates using spray paint, house paint, and acrylic paint. You can find his “Creeps” on the walls of private collections across the country, as well as Austin galleries and streets.
